Multiple layout in angularjs. in/Create different layout Templates1.
Multiple layout in angularjs Dive into code examples showcasing the power of Flexbox CSS in Angular applications. Jul 30, 2022 · I want to make several different module layouts For example, I made one separate layout and named it user. html#!/phones and the phone list appears in the browser. We use standalone components, modern control flow, and the built-in Router and HttpClient in examples. Let's route through those AngularJS is what HTML would have been, had it been designed for building web-apps. Oct 18, 2022 · Modern CSS layouts The two most recommended modern CSS layout solutions are CSS Flexbox and CSS Grid. -- You received this message because you are subscribed to the Google Groups "Angular and AngularJS discussion" group. See Material Design spec here. Jul 9, 2013 · I'm developing an AngularJS application with a RoR backend and ran into an issue when using multiple layouts. This article provides an overview of Angular components, including their structure, features, and how to create and use them effectively. This tree builds on the foundation of the CDK tree and uses a similar interface for its data source input and template, except that its element and attribute selectors will be prefixed with mat- instead of cdk-. However, the align property on <mat-card-actions> can be used to position the actions at the 'start' or 'end' of the container. Template for heade Apr 28, 2024 · 28 April, 2024 9 Best AngularJS Bootstrap Templates 2025 We made sure to save you a lot of time when creating a list of trustworthy AngularJS Bootstrap templates. g. Declarative templates with data-binding, MVC, dependency injection and great testability story all implemented with pure client-side JavaScript! Apr 18, 2016 · I want to design a dropdownlist of checkboxes and make the checkboxes multi-selectable. Explore how to create responsive UIs using Angular Flex Layout. Usually an AngularJS app has only one injector and modules are only loaded once. Bootstrap’s grid system uses a series of containers, rows, and columns to layout and align content. To unsubscribe from this group and stop receiving emails from it, send an email to angular+unsubscr@googlegroups. Below is an example (please note the presence of a play button, as the free GIF creator comes with some less-than-cool features). 3. I wanna make a simple about me page How should I go about it? Jul 23, 2025 · Next JS Layout components are commonly used to structure the overall layout of a website or web application. You can see a Flexbox in Angular demo here: The web development framework for building modern apps. UI Select A native AngularJS implementation of Select2/Selectize by the AngularUI Team Code on Github Tweet The button-toggles will present themselves as either checkboxes or radio-buttons based on the presence of the multiple attribute. What I want is to use this same layout but with the content part changing depending on what I want to add on the current page. This project provides a set of reusable, well-tested, and accessible UI components for AngularJS developers. Admins, dashboards, and other web apps are all possible with these. standalone: true — The recommended approach of streamlining the authoring experience of components styles — A string or array of strings that contains any CSS styles you want applied to the component Knowing this, here is an updated version of our TodoListItem component. Apr 12, 2025 · Grid System Layout is a great tool for creating layouts that are optimized for mobile devices. One which is basically 1 column (kind of as a landing page) and one which has a menu at the top, and is basically the same 1 column layout. Each module can only be loaded once per injector. I currently have a root state which defaults to using a certain layout and then within that layout contains named ui-view directives for sections such as the header, footer, sidebar etc. Using other Angular components and the CSS grid. html file which is like a master page (gets applied to all the pages in the app). For example layout which consists of header, footer and sidebar, which are fixed for each page, and the content which varies by the page. Dec 6, 2014 · Use nested states with the AngularJS UI-Router to simulate a multiple layout web application reducing repetitive code and promoting quality code. html is on the root dir Jan 1, 2019 · AngularJS Material is an implementation of Google's Material Design Specification (2014-2017). Aug 31, 2023 · Explore Angular 15's standalone components for efficient app development. I have many layouts that I would like to use with different templates based on routes. CSS Grid Layout The CSS Grid Layout Module offers a grid-based layout system, with rows and columns, making it easier to design web pages without having to use floats and positioning. The application uses one layout when rendering pages to an unauthenticated user, and ch Feb 28, 2018 · Using AngularJS + UI-Router it is quite easy to have the "master-page" independent from your route, but i dont immediately see how i can easily reproduce this with the Angular 5 router. These tools are at the top of their game, with a 100% fluid layout, lightweight structure, and well-organized code. html, you are redirected to /index. Whether for work or multitasking, this feature makes it easy to arrange your desktop for maximum productivity. . Perhaps opening up something else might have a completely different layout (with its own submenu - possibly horizontal). We begin using Angular Flex-Layout attributes to align the sidebar and content. Can Angular handle multiple layouts like this? Or would I actually need to build separate applications for each type of layout!? Sep 26, 2012 · Layout Template When we talk about multiple views, we will definitely come across various resources that are used by all the views. Rows wise layouts with images2. Based on the Angular docs, Pluralsight courses and other materials I found, I came up with two Nov 18, 2022 · Learn how to implement different layout frames for various routes in Angular applications, customizing views like login and home pages effectively. Improve this Doc In this step, you will learn how to create a layout template and how to build an application that has multiple views by adding routing, using an AngularJS module called ngRoute. GoldenLayout- a multi-window javascript layout manager for webappsUsing GoldenLayout with Angular Angular’s popularity is exploding and it’s easy to see why: It provides a set of solutions to common problems and good integration-points for usage of third part components. blogspot. all i have to do is put two value start number and end number , it will represent index of the returned json array. Jan 15, 2016 · I have an angularjs app, which has app. These elements primary serve as pre-styled content containers without any additional APIs. There are two types of trees: Flat tree and nested tree. message = 'Hello world from Controller Most of the web apps I worked on so far, had a design where different pages are using common layout. Learn more about CSS grids in our CSS Grid Intro chapter. GitHub Re Learn the basics of Angular flex layout and its directives with practical examples in this comprehensive tutorial. Guided by two engineers who worked on AngularJS at Google, you’ll walk through the framework’s key features, and then build a working AngularJS app—from layout to testing, compiling, and debugging. In the main layout, I made a Use our powerful mobile-first flexbox grid to build layouts of all shapes and sizes thanks to a twelve column system, six default responsive tiers, Sass variables and mixins, and dozens of predefined classes. Logical idea is to try to extract and reuse common parts. I have a project for which I need 2 layouts. You’ll learn how AngularJS helps reduce the complexity of your web app. Learn to create flexible layouts with self-contained components. Jan 1, 2019 · Children within a Layout Container To customize the size and position of elements in a layout container, use the flex, flex-order, and flex-offset attributes on the container's child elements: Jan 14, 2016 · I want to use multiple server layout on meanjs framework, but the problem is how I can attach some angular front-end view page to specific server layout, I have a special login page that have a dif Apr 3, 2013 · I need to be able to specify different layouts for different routes, and most preferably I would like to be able to define layouts and other parameters in an object in route config and have them Angular is one of the finest JavaScript frameworks of all time. For button toggles containing only icons, each button toggle should be given a meaningful label via aria-label or aria-labelledby. Sep 10, 2014 · multiple layout with angularjs in asp. Jan 12, 2020 · Angular customisable layout creation Let your end-users configure their own application layout with drag-n-drops…. We will explore those through this video and create a simple app, which will have two layouts. Feb 24, 2022 · Learn how to make your Angular components and applications responsive without having to write a single media query. link Card headers In addition to the aforementioned sections, <mat-card-header> gives the ability to add a rich header to a card. module('myApp', ['ui. js (main js file where app starts), index. Nov 15, 2018 · Today web apps often have a common layout for different pages. Each test has its own injector and modules are loaded multiple times. we can define column size as 'xs', 'sm', 'md', 'xl' , and 'xxl'. here i have solve my angularJS pagination issue with some more tweak in server side + view end you can check the code it will be more efficient. They provide a convenient way to maintain consistent header, footer, and other navigation elements across multiple pages In this article, we will learn to set up Multiple Layouts in NextJS. We have to customise the appearance of applications time and again taking into account many various aspects. The Angular flex layout code is easier to maintain and debug As we know, Angular has its own Router and it can be used in many ways. What we are going to Windows 11 introduces an enhanced feature called Snap Layouts, allowing users to efficiently split and manage multiple open windows. In a follow up post, we will take our accordion out of the controller and abstract it into an Angular directive, making it fully dynamic and much more […] Small, structured modules help keep unit tests concise and focused. In all of these examples we are going to assume this module definition: Dec 27, 2024 · Learn how to create a responsive layout with Angular and CSS Grid, perfect for modern web development. Ideal for modular architecture. CSS Flexbox Flexbox is a one-dimensional layout method that allows you to arrange items in rows or columns. Items flex (expand) to fill additional space or shrink to fit into smaller spaces. Basically, grid system layout built with flexbox which makes it fully responsive. Learn AngularJS - Multiple Viewsapp. mat-grid-list is a two-dimensional list view that arranges cells into grid-based layout. In this tutorial we will create a fully functional accordion in an Angular controller. Explore Angular Flex-Layout demos showcasing responsive design and layout techniques for web development. This means that no matter your choice, you unlock Apr 19, 2020 · ⏳ A few months ago I wrote an article about dynamic layouts in Vue. router']) . net mvc Asked 10 years, 5 months ago Modified 9 years, 6 months ago Viewed 1k times But with this new Angular flexbox layout we can directly define flexbox layout settings inside the HTML template with the help of flexbox directives. This article explains how we can achieve that using Angular router. I have used the below code,but I am unable to make multiple selections as the template refreshes each time I Sep 5, 2014 · 12 I want to have multiple layouts (1-col, 2-col, 3-col) which I want to switch out for different routes based on the layout needed. com. Read this blog that analyzes the Best Angularjs Dashboard Templates of all time in detail. GoldenLayout) however can be challenging. Using Angular within third party components (e. Thus, we collect all such resources which will be shared by all the views and put them in a file called “layout template”. I just started learning Angular. <Routes> component is similar to react-router@5 Switch: docs. js. js angular. For example the AngularJS library will be used by all the views. When you now navigate to /index. Jul 23, 2025 · Parent components can provide content for each slot, allowing for granular control over the layout and structure of the composed UI. But fear not, this tutorial In this video, you will learn to create multiple layouts in Angular. Now, I have two layouts, one main, root layout and user layout. The DOM structures are Sep 28, 2018 · Angular Flex-Layout: Flexbox and Grid Layout for Angular Component AngularInDepth is moving away from Medium. Here's an example how to you can use multiple layouts with multiple routes: I am very new to web development. The mat-tree provides a Material Design styled tree that can be used to display hierarchy data. This header can contain: May 27, 2016 · Multiple layouts with Angular Asked 11 years, 8 months ago Modified 9 years, 3 months ago Viewed 1k times I am trying to setup a complex AngularJS based application with multiple templates and layouts. Is there any way to detect the params or scope variable in the Angular Client App and dynamically load a partial inside the main Layout. Angular allows you to organise the presentation layer to easily handle multiple layouts. When you click on a phone link, the URL changes to that specific phone and May 23, 2017 · Of course, I only want to fetch this dynamic submenu once. controller('controllerOne', function() { this. Aug 31, 2018 · In case of complex projects it is often expected to provide different layouts adapted to the needs of users – the logged-in user requires different UI elements than the guest. Basically I made a holy grail layout component that has header, main content, etc. But i don't really understand the routing mechanism of angularjs, so i am looking for further explanation about it and maybe some examples if possible. Jan 1, 2022 · EDITED: Multiple routed with multiple layouts can be done by using <Outlet> component in layouts and <Route> component composition. This article, its updates and more recent articles are hosted on the new platform … Apr 16, 2024 · Angular Components are the building blocks of Angular applications, containing the template, styles, and behavior of a part of the user interface. in/Create different layout Templates1. Advantages of Angular flex layout When compare to AngularJS Material layout, angular flex layout has several advantages. Apr 27, 2016 · 1 I am trying to setup a complex AngularJS based application with multiple templates and layouts. Dec 10, 2015 · My question is Can we have multiple Server Layouts, ? If the logged-in user is Regular User, use layout-1 if the user is Admin use layout-2 If we cannot have multiple server layout (I presume it isn't possible). Support for Transclusion: Multi-slot content projection builds upon Angular's transclusion feature, allowing you to project content into multiple named slots within a component's template. https://angularjsappdevelopment. This index. Oct 17, 2015 · Ben Nadel experiments with creating an AngularJS directive that uses multiple points of transclusion to create a layout component directive. Imagine a dashboard application where you have several widget that act as … Jan 1, 2019 · AngularJS Material is an implementation of Google's Material Design Specification (2014-2017). Currently, I have the same proble Tagged with angular, typescript, webdev, beginners. Rows and columns Layout. May 24, 2023 · In this article, we’ll explore a use case where we tackle the challenge of implementing a collapsible sidenav that can be resized by dragging a border, and seamlessly adjusting the screen layout. Dec 19, 2013 · In this tutorial, we will learn how to create an accordion using Angular. Overview & Prerequisites Learn Angular step-by-step with easy-to-follow pages and runnable JS-only examples. adaelj pyui bhkkjx zog fnvkxhr dqqtp ozijnebp hyral fzf ilge sqyxttx fmzao zwcpowiw ktzn ewx